Salary Trajectory for Police Officers in Huntington (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.06%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$30,240 | Actual |
| 2020 | $32,470 | Actual |
| 2021 | $37,550 | Actual |
| 2022 | $36,030 | Actual |
| 2023 | $37,380 | Actual |
| 2024 | $40,200 | Actual |
| 2025 | $40,140 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$41,368 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$42,634 | Projected |
Entry-level police officer compensation (10th percentile) in Huntington, WV grew 32.7% over 7 years based on actual BLS metropolitan area surveys, rising from $30,240 in 2019 to $40,140 in 2025. By 2027, starting salaries are projected to reach $42,634. New graduates entering the Huntington job market can expect continued year-over-year gains.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Huntington met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.06%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Starting Your law enforcement Career in Huntington
In the Huntington area, various departments are open to hiring recent POST academy graduates, offering a structured pathway into law enforcement. Municipal departments typically engage new officers through local academies, while state police recruit through state resources. Additionally, opportunities with campus and transit police can serve as stepping stones for new officers aspiring to municipal roles. To enhance starting salaries, candidates should aim for certification through the Police Officer Standards and Training (POST) academy, complemented by performance in physical and psychological evaluations.
